Environmental Health and Safety

Environmental Health & Safety (EHS) at Missouri Western State University supports a safe, healthy, and compliant campus environment through the coordination of safety programs, regulatory compliance efforts, and operational support services.

EHS programs are carried out in partnership with campus departments and coordinated through Physical Plant operations. The Office of Risk Management supports institutional oversight and compliance coordination by assisting with program alignment, documentation, training guidance, and risk-based recommendations.

EHS Coordinator Responsibilities

The Environmental Health & Safety (EHS) Coordinator supports campus operations by assisting with the implementation and coordination of EHS-related services, including:

  • Hazardous Waste Management (including collection, storage, and regulatory compliance requirements)
  • Chemical Safety Support and hazardous materials coordination
  • Pest Control Coordination (including reporting and vendor support)
  • Indoor Environmental Concerns (air quality concerns, odors, and building-related safety observations)
  • Safety Inspections and Operational Safety Support
  • Coordination of corrective actions with Physical Plant and departments when hazards are identified
  • Support for compliance requirements related to OSHA and applicable safety standards
